How to Make a Dog Costume from a T-Shirt

You can get that pup ready for Halloween, a local parade or a child's party with this quick custom costume that is cheap, fun and disposable.

Things You'll Need

  • T-shirt
  • Scissors
  • Permanent markers
  • Tape measure
  • Glitter pens, fake flower, big buttons, bows (optional)
  • Finger paint (optional)
  • Child-sized foam visor (optional)

Instructions

    • 1

      Try a small t-shirt on your dog. The dog's head goes through the neck and its front feet go through the sleeves. If the shirt fits a little baggy, that is exactly the right size. Take the shirt off the dog.

    • 2

      Cut the sleeves out of the T-shirt with the scissors. Ragged is fine. No binding or stitching is needed. Also cut away the belly so that your dog can walk easily and do the piddle chores.

    • 3

      Make a small cut at the neck if the shirt does not fit easily over your dog's head so the shirt goes on smoothly. You do not want to injure your dog's ears or eyes by squeezing a tight shirt over its head.

    • 4

      Put the pattern side so it shows on the dog's back. Otherwise you can decorate a white T-shirt with glitter pens, fake flowers, big buttons, a lacy edge or other gaudy features.

    • 5

      Turn your dog into an autograph hound. Use the permanent marker to sign or print names on the back and sides of the shirt. If you have children, let them write their names on the shirt in black or assorted colors, or let them put hand prints on the shirt with finger paint.

    • 6

      Measure your dog around the chest at the widest point if you are going to purchase a T-shirt for this purpose. This is the minimum size T-shirt that you can buy, but larger is better because it will go on and off the dog more easily. Shop for a colorful cheap shirt and cut out the sleeves and belly.

    • 7

      Add a child's foam visor if your dog is patient. Dress your dog up just before the event and use lots of treats to keep your canine happy. If you feel really adventurous, make a matching T-shirt for the dog escort.

Tips & Warnings

  • Do not put too many things on your dog, the dog will be impaired and will not like the fuss.

  • If your dog panics or struggles in the shirt, take it off.
